Former Aztecs men's basketball players Carrasco and Bessard named NAIA All-Americans

Former Pima Community College men's basketball players Abram Carrasco (Cholla HS) and Justin Bessard earned recognition from the National Association of Intercollegiate Athletics.

  • Carrasco and Bessard played for the Westmont College Warriors (CA) this season and were selected NAIA All-Americans.
  • Carrasco, a junior, was named first team All-American as he led the Warriors averaging 18.9 points and 4.8 assists. This is the second straight year he has been named a first team All-American. Carrasco holds the record for most points scored in a Pima men's basketball career with 1,310 points.
  • Bessard, a senior, was selected NAIA Honorable Mention All-American. He averaged 15.1 points and 7.0 rebounds per game.
  • Carrasco and Bessard were part of the 2018 Aztecs team that finished runner-up at the NJCAA Division II National Tournament.
